Ronald W. Simmons Jr. is the 2018 North Carolina Small Farmer of the Year

Last week, the Cooperative Extension Program at N.C. A&T State University celebrated its 32nd annual Small Farms Week. The event celebrates the contributions of small-scale producers in North Carolina who generate $250,000 or less annually in agricultural gross sales. This year’s theme was “Small Farms, Big Impact.” That statement is certainly true in North Carolina. […]

Beekeepers can apply for new beehive grant

Beekeepers can apply for new beehive grant

Interest in beekeeping has grown exponentially since the North Carolina State Beekeepers Association signed their first 38 charter members in 1917. Today, the NCSBA has grown to 4,000 members and has become one of the largest organizations working to protect and promote the honeybee.
